INGREDIENTS
Lamb
- ๐ 1 pound cubed lamb stew meat
Vegetables
- ๐ง 1 large onion, sliced into petals
- ๐ฅ 1 pound red potatoes, cut into large cubes
- ๐ฅ 2 large carrots, sliced
- 2 stalks celery, sliced
- ๐ 4 fresh button mushrooms, sliced
- 1 ยฝ cups frozen peas
Liquid & Seasoning
- 2 cups beef broth
- ๐ 1 (6 ounce) can tomato paste
- ยฝ cup beer
- 3 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
- 1 large sprig fresh rosemary
- ๐ง Salt and pepper to taste
Oil
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
STEPS
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add lamb and onions; cook and stir until lamb is browned and onions are starting to soften, about 5 minutes. Transfer lamb mixture to a slow cooker.
Add potatoes, carrots, celery, and mushrooms. Stir in beef broth, tomato paste, beer, Worcestershire sauce, rosemary, salt, and pepper; cover.
Cook on High for 7 hours. Add peas and cook for an additional 15 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.

๐ก For a richer flavor, you can sear the lamb in small batches to form a better crust before adding it to the slow cooker.Use fresh, high-quality rosemary for the best aroma.If you prefer a thicker stew, mix a tablespoon of cornstarch with water and stir in during the last 30 minutes of cooking.
